From e0ccedbae174f660714e1fb44225ec51dc97ad16 Mon Sep 17 00:00:00 2001 From: Pierre Riteau Date: Thu, 27 Apr 2023 12:15:02 +0200 Subject: [PATCH] Install cephadm without weak dependencies The latest cephadm package installs podman as a weak dependency. Disable weak dependencies and assume that Docker or Podman is already installed and configured. --- roles/cephadm/tasks/pkg_redhat.yml | 1 + 1 file changed, 1 insertion(+) diff --git a/roles/cephadm/tasks/pkg_redhat.yml b/roles/cephadm/tasks/pkg_redhat.yml index 24b57f0..dd0a378 100644 --- a/roles/cephadm/tasks/pkg_redhat.yml +++ b/roles/cephadm/tasks/pkg_redhat.yml @@ -29,6 +29,7 @@ - name: Install cephadm package dnf: name: "cephadm" + install_weak_deps: false state: "{{ 'latest' if cephadm_package_update | bool else 'present' }}" update_cache: true become: true